To really understand Thailand and how it became what it is today, you have to visit the former capital of Ayutthaya. The ruin brick tempels are all that is left from the glory days of Thailand. While wondering around the Buddha statues and immense palaces that were contsructed by slaves and farmers, you will feel the grandeur of this ancient Kingdom. The wat Chai Wattanaram temple is located on teh Chao Praya riverbanks and is so well preserved it still sparks the imagination of ancient times. Nearby Thai Kings traded animal skins, gold, gem stones, herbs and much more with foreign countries like Holland, Japan and Portugal. The foundations of the city acted as a blueprint for Bangkok and you will know everything what happened before the capital switched from Ayutthaya to Bangkok. After this tour you will know why Thailand was never colonized by foreign powers and why we are so proud to be Thai. 09. 00 Depart Bangkok. 10. 30 Arrive at Wat Chai Wattanaram temple. 11. 30 Take boat ride around the island of Ayutthaya and see the city in a different way. 12. 30 Arrive at local market and have a delicious local lunch. 14. 00 Visit to the Wat Mahatat temple. 14. 45 Visit to Wat Phra Si Sanphet ancient palace grounds. 17. 00 Back at your hotel in Bangkok.
